One person died when tropical storm Lala landed in Hawaii, on Monday.
A power outage affected 117,000 households, in Kula, Hāʻikū, Olinda and Piʻiholo, along with parts of West, Central and South Maui.
There are fallen trees on power lines and damaged infrastructure.
The National Weather Service (NWS) of County of Maui said the storm continues to move west of the main Hawaiian Islands.
Lala brought hurricane-force winds — gusts of 85 mph in Olowalu and 82 mph in Ukumehame, along with heavy rain and flooding, on Saturday.
